Caption

Fall prevention and recovery training, CPR and first aid certification, a duty to provide aid in certain residential facilities and hospices, and granting rule-making authority. (FE)

Impact

The bill imposes a duty on these facilities to have trained staff consistently present to provide immediate aid in case of emergencies. Specifically, each facility must have an employee who is certified in CPR, first aid, and fall prevention on-site at all times when residents are present. Moreover, these facilities are mandated to provide ongoing training to their employees and immediate training to new residents upon their admission.

Summary

Senate Bill 884 mandates the Department of Health Services to develop fall prevention and recovery training programs for employees and residents of various care facilities including residential care apartment complexes, community-based residential facilities, nursing homes, and hospices. This bill seeks to ensure that staff are adequately trained to prevent falls, recover residents post-fall, and respond during medical emergencies by administering CPR or first aid as necessary.

Contention

While proponents argue that this law will enhance resident safety and care quality in assisted living environments, critics express concerns about the potential strain it may place on smaller facilities. They fear that the financial and operational burdens of meeting these training and staffing requirements could overwhelm facilities, or lead to closures, thus limiting options for care in certain regions. Additionally, the issue of liability exemption for caregivers under certain conditions is a point of legal debate, raising questions about the adequacy of protections for both staff and residents.
